Moussa Benzaid
Algerian footballer (born 1999) From Wikipedia, the free encyclopedia
Remove ads
Moussa Saad Eddine Benzaid (Tamazight: ⵎⵓⵙⵙⴰ ⵙⴰⴰⴷ ⴻⴷⴷⵉⵏⴻ ⴱⴻⵏⵣⴰⵉⴷ; born 9 March 1999) is an Algerian professional footballer who plays as a centre-back for Libyan Premier League club Asswehly SC.

Club career
Moussa Benzaid was born in Ouargla, Algeria.[1][2][3] He is a youth product of CR Béni Thour, until 2018. He joined the U21 team of CA Bordj Bou Arreridj in 2019.[1]
Later he went on to join Algerian second division side HB Chelghoum Laïd in 2020 for his amateur debut,[citation needed] then in 2021, he signed a five-year contract with JS Kabylie for his professional debut. In 2023, he scored his first goal with JS Kabylie against AS Vita Club in the group stage of the 2022–23 CAF Champions League.[4] In 2025, he was transferred by JS Kabylie to Libyan Premier League club Asswehly SC. With Asswehly SC, he signed a contract, until the end of the 2027–28 season.

Style of play
In Algeria, he is compared by many football fans to Antonio Rüdiger, in his ability to win many duels on the field. With a powerful game and great combativeness, he has also an athletic profile similar to former Algerian left-back Abderraouf Zarabi.[5]
